本文目录导读:
随着大数据时代的到来,数据库技术也在不断发展和演进,MPP数据库作为一种新兴的数据库技术,以其独特的架构和优势,受到了广泛关注,本文将从MPP数据库的架构、优势以及未来发展趋势等方面进行深入解析,以期为读者提供全面了解。
MPP数据库概述
MPP数据库,全称为Massively Parallel Processing(大规模并行处理)数据库,它是一种采用分布式架构的数据库,通过将数据分割成多个子集,在多个节点上并行处理,从而实现高性能、高并发的数据处理能力。
MPP数据库架构
1、分布式架构:MPP数据库采用分布式架构,将数据分散存储在多个节点上,每个节点负责处理一部分数据,节点之间通过网络进行通信。
2、数据分区:MPP数据库将数据按照一定的规则进行分区,每个节点只存储和处理部分数据,这样可以提高数据处理的并行度,降低数据传输压力。
图片来源于网络,如有侵权联系删除
3、并行计算:MPP数据库采用并行计算技术,将计算任务分配给多个节点同时执行,每个节点独立完成计算任务,然后将结果汇总。
4、数据库管理:MPP数据库采用集中式管理,通过统一的数据库管理系统进行数据管理、查询优化、负载均衡等操作。
MPP数据库优势
1、高性能:MPP数据库采用分布式架构和并行计算技术,可以实现海量数据的快速处理,满足大规模数据处理需求。
2、高并发:MPP数据库支持多用户同时访问,满足高并发场景下的数据处理需求。
3、易扩展:MPP数据库采用分布式架构,可以方便地进行水平扩展,提高系统性能。
4、高可用性:MPP数据库通过数据冗余、故障转移等机制,提高系统的高可用性。
图片来源于网络,如有侵权联系删除
5、良好的兼容性:MPP数据库支持多种编程语言和接口,方便用户进行开发和维护。
MPP数据库应用场景
1、大数据分析:MPP数据库可以处理海量数据,满足大数据分析需求。
2、商业智能:MPP数据库支持复杂的查询和分析,适用于商业智能应用。
3、电子商务:MPP数据库可以处理高并发访问,满足电子商务平台的数据处理需求。
4、金融风控:MPP数据库可以处理海量金融数据,满足金融风控需求。
MPP数据库未来发展趋势
1、自适应优化:MPP数据库将采用自适应优化技术,根据数据特点、查询需求等因素自动调整查询计划,提高查询效率。
图片来源于网络,如有侵权联系删除
2、云原生:MPP数据库将逐步向云原生方向发展,实现弹性扩展、按需付费等特性。
3、边缘计算:MPP数据库将结合边缘计算技术,实现数据在边缘节点进行预处理,降低数据传输成本。
4、多模数据库:MPP数据库将支持多种数据模型,满足不同场景下的数据处理需求。
MPP数据库作为一种新兴的数据库技术,以其独特的架构和优势,在处理海量数据、高并发场景下具有显著优势,随着大数据时代的到来,MPP数据库将在更多领域得到应用,成为未来数据库技术的重要发展方向。
标签: #mpp 数据库
评论列表